appleseed vs python(x,y): The Verdict

⚡ Summary:

appleseed: appleseed is an open-source, physically-based global illumination rendering engine designed for producing high-quality CGI animations and visual effects. It uses Monte Carlo ray tracing techniques to simulate light transport realistically and accurately.

python(x,y): python(x,y) is an open-source mathematical plotting and data visualization library for the Python programming language. It provides a simple interface for creating 2D plots, histograms, power spectra, bar charts, errorcharts, contour plots, etc.

Key Features Comparison

appleseed
appleseed Features
  • Physically based rendering
  • Spectral rendering pipeline
  • Bidirectional path tracing
  • Metropolis light transport
  • Progressive photon mapping
  • Texture baking
  • Alembic support
